Hi Benjamin,
Thanks for the feedback, I agree with most of it.

To answer some of your questions:
You can floodfill with transparency using the flood fill tool by holding Ctrl/Cmd.
The color replacer tool only affects pixels that have the secondary color, you can also replace colors globally using Color > Replace current color.
I probably won't add an indexed color mode to keep it simple, but you can replace colors globally. Is there any other advantage of an indexed palette? Maybe I can add equivalent functionality without a separate mode.
